Description
This is an 18th-century bridge made of ironstone and limestone ashlar, along with brick. It features a single voussoired arch and has a plain parapet with low flanking walls. The bridge is located between a mill pond and a water channel that leads from the lake in the park of Edgcote House. There is also lock machinery from the 20th century on a platform to the south of the bridge, though this is not of special architectural interest.
